Move furniture carefully
Never drag or push. Not only can this damage your furniture, it can also scrape or scratch your flooring. When moving heavy pieces of furniture such as a sofa, ask for help to lift and move it to the desired location.

Tighten screws
With regular use, furniture joints can become loose, so be sure to tighten screws regularly. If a chair is wobbly, take it out of service until you can fix it.
Polish the hardware
Avoid polishes that contain ammonia, since it could cause corrosion. Use a polish with a mild abrasive. And when polishing brass hardware or furniture, protect the rest of the finish with masking tape. Or remove the hardware before polishing. This will make your hardware on furniture last longer.
